In the Lutheran faith we have two sacraments, Baptism and Holy Communion. Making your Holy Communion in the fourth grade is extremely important not only in being a part of St. Luke’s, but also a part of the larger Christian faith. The whole Sunday School year for fourth graders is built to prepare them to receive this sacrament.

The information for students is as follows: attend Sunday school on a regular basis, fulfill the family service requirement, attend FHC classes in the month leading up to First Holy Communion.

Family Service Requirement: As a family, you will assist the Altar Guild in reading the church for the Sunday Worship. This includes but is not limited to, picking up garbage inside the church, wiping down the window sills and pews, refilling the pencils and supplies in the backs of each pew.

This work can be completed in 30m time and will take place on Tuesday nights.
